What all sources covered
- The European Parliament approved the revision of EU social security coordination rules on July 7, 2026.
- The vote took place during a plenary session in Strasbourg.
- The revision amends regulations 883/2004 and 987/2009.
- The approval came with 511 votes in favor.
- This change will impact how social security systems are coordinated across EU member states.
